Key Insights of Japan Plastic Surgery Electrosurgical Units (ESUs) Market

  • Market Size (2023): Estimated at approximately $150 million, reflecting steady demand driven by aesthetic procedures and technological advancements.
  • Forecast Value (2033): Projected to reach around $250 million, with a CAGR of 6.1% from 2026 to 2033, driven by demographic shifts and rising cosmetic awareness.
  • Leading Segment: Electrosurgical generators with advanced features such as precision control and integration capabilities dominate, accounting for over 60% of sales.
  • Core Application: Primarily used in facial rejuvenation, body contouring, and reconstructive surgeries, with minimally invasive procedures fueling demand.
  • Leading Geography: Tokyo Metropolitan Area holds the largest market share, benefiting from high patient volume and technological adoption.
  • Key Market Opportunity: Growing adoption of AI-enabled ESUs and integration with robotic surgical systems present significant expansion avenues.
  • Major Companies: Ethicon (Johnson & Johnson), Medtronic, Bovie Medical, and local players like Nihon Kohden are prominent industry leaders.

Dynamic Market Forces Influencing Japan Plastic Surgery ESU Sector

  • Porter’s Five Forces Analysis: Competitive rivalry remains intense with high product differentiation; supplier power is moderate due to specialized components; buyer power is elevated owing to hospital procurement processes; threat of new entrants is mitigated by regulatory barriers; threat of substitutes is low but rising with alternative energy-based devices.
  • Regulatory Environment: Strict approval processes by Japan’s Pharmaceuticals and Medical Devices Agency (PMDA) influence product development timelines and compliance costs.
  • Customer Preferences: Increasing demand for minimally invasive, safe, and technologically advanced devices shapes product innovation and marketing strategies.
  • Supply Chain Dynamics: Dependence on specialized components and global logistics impacts pricing and availability, especially amidst geopolitical uncertainties.
  • Innovation Ecosystem: Collaboration between academia, startups, and established players accelerates technological breakthroughs and market entry strategies.
